You can use screw modifier to get the result. here is a quick demonstration
add circles like these in a mesh. more circles means more rings. Use smaller circle to get the result as shown in the ref.
then make sure the origin is in the 3d cursor. Now add a screw modifier and tweak the settings as shown. Use the iterations value to increase the length of the wires.
